An Azure Cosmos DB for MongoDB (vCore) Mongo Cluster — a managed, production MongoDB-compatible database cluster resource and its control-plane configuration (SKU, node topology, networking, settings).

A production data store supporting a single organizational function; its data plane holds organizational data and its connection strings are credentials.


Microsoft.​DocumentDB/​mongoClusters/​listConnectionStrings/​action

Returns connection strings embedding cluster credentials; an attacker redeems them for direct authenticated access to read and exfiltrate all database contents, mirroring the listKeys precedent.
